Collecting vs. Hoarding
In my opinion there is a big difference between hoarding and collecting. People who collect just find certain things interesting and like to see multiple variations of an object. People who hoard have emotional connections and feel like they will eventually have a use for stuff so they have trouble throwing things out. Plus collecting have a theme while hoarding is random.
the difference is clear.

In my candy drawing I used colored pencil for almost the entire drawing. I learned a lot about how to create value using different shades of colors instead of regular pencil. I found this pretty difficult but i love drawing with colored pencil because of the way they blend together and how creamy the color is.
The difference between my bike drawing and my candy drawing is very noticeable. In my bike drawing it looks more realistic because I found it easier to create value with regular graphite pencils rather then colored pencil. Using colored pencils was a lot more fun because of the white pencil that was used for the shine. This was especially fun when drawing the celliphane on the mint candy.
